🗺️ Top Destinations in Rajasthan Wildlife Tour Packages
🐅 1. Ranthambore National Park (Sawai Madhopur)
  • Famous for Bengal tiger sightings
  • Home to leopards, sloth bears, marsh crocodiles
  • Best time: October to April
Must-Do: Tiger safari, Ranthambore Fort visit, jungle photography workshop

🦌 2. Sariska Tiger Reserve (Alwar)
  • Closer to Delhi, great for weekend wildlife getaways
  • Houses Royal Bengal Tigers, hyenas, sambars, and langurs
  • Sariska Palace stay adds royal touch

🦢 3. Keoladeo Ghana Bird Sanctuary (Bharatpur)
  • UNESCO World Heritage Site
  • Paradise for bird watchers and ornithologists
  • Spot Siberian cranes, painted storks, pelicans, kingfishers
Best Time: November to March

🦊 4. Desert National Park (Jaisalmer)
  • A rare desert ecosystem with Indian bustards, foxes, and eagles
  • Offers Jeep safaris and desert camping
  • Combine with a Jaisalmer cultural experience
🦎 5. Mount Abu Wildlife Sanctuary
  • The only hill station in Rajasthan
  • Rich in flora, with species like Indian leopard, wild boar, and jungle cat
  • Perfect for cooler months and nature hikes

🛡️ Responsible Wildlife Tourism Practices
  • Always book with eco-conscious, licensed tour operators
  • Follow park rules: no feeding animals, no littering, silence during safaris
  • Respect local communities and tribal zones
  • Avoid plastic and opt for reusable bottles and bags

🧠 Travel Tips for Wildlife Tours
  • Best Time to Visit: October to April
  • Carry: Binoculars, camera with telephoto lens, neutral clothing, sunscreen
  • Safari Timings: Usually morning (6–10 AM) & evening (3–6 PM) slots
  • Permits & ID: Book safaris in advance with proper ID proof
